Redeem vouchers in Kitomba 1
You can redeem vouchers as a payment type when making a sale with Kitomba 1 Point-of-sale.
1. On the Take payment screen, select Voucher as the payment type from the drop down menu.
2. Enter the voucher code to search for the voucher.
Note: If your payment settings allow for untracked vouchers to be redeemed you’ll also see an option to proceed without voucher code.
3. Enter the redemption amount of the voucher if different from the amount shown. Kitomba 1 will automatically display either the full amount of the voucher, or the full amount of the invoice, whichever is lower.
4. Select Redeem to apply the amount to the invoice.
When redeeming a tracked voucher, the voucher’s new balance will be updated automatically once the sale is processed.
Download or Import lists of vouchers
Download vouchers
1. Select Download button. This will provide you with an excel spreadsheet.
Import vouchers
You can import a batch of vouchers created outside of Kitomba, for example, from a daily deals website.
1. To Import a list of vouchers select Import button.
2. Structure your voucher numbers as specified in the voucher instructions and import the list so you can track redemption's.

Create free vouchers
If you’d like to run a promotion or giveaway, you can create free vouchers in Kitomba 1. They can be redeemed and tracked just like regular vouchers.
1. To create free vouchers select the +Free vouchers button.
2. Enter in the quantity, value of each voucher, the expiry date and any notes.
3. Select Create a new batch.
4. Give the batch a name.
5. Select Create.
6. Selecting the Select existing batch option allows you to create more vouchers within that batch.
